LONDON — Toyota dealers in the U.K. have started taking orders for the new Aygo Black, a special edition of the popular European minicar that is priced from $14,300-$16,400, depending on body style and equipment.
Available in three- and five-door variants, the Black edition is based on the well-equipped Aygo+. Toyota fits leather and Alcantara upholstery, leather-trimmed sport steering wheel and gearshift knob, 14-inch alloy wheels and Tempest Black metallic paint.
Among the options are air-conditioning, automatic transmission, foglamps and aluminum scuff plates.
The Aygo Black is equipped with a 1.0-liter VVT-i gas engine and five-speed manual gearbox, a combination that delivers 50 mpg and CO2 emissions of only 106 g/km.
